ctlptl
ctlptl (pronounced "cattle paddle") is a CLI for declaratively setting up local Kubernetes clusters.

Inspired by kubectl and ClusterAPI's clusterctl, you declare your local cluster with YAML and use ctlptl to set it up.

PowerfulSeal
PowerfulSeal injects failure into your Kubernetes clusters, so that you can detect problems as early as possible. It allows for writing scenarios describing complete chaos experiments.

kubectl-images
kubectl-images makes use of the kubectl command. It first calls kubectl get pods to retrieve pods details and filters out the container image information of each pod, then prints out the final result in a table view.

Ten Commandments of Egoless Programming
1. Understand and accept that you will make mistakes.
2. You are not your code.
3. No matter how much "karate" you know, someone else will always know more.
4. Don't rewrite code without consultation.
5. Treat people who know less than you with respect and patience.
6. The only constant in the world is change.
7. The only true authority stems from knowledge, not from position.
8. Fight for what you believe, but gracefully accept defeat.
9. Don't be "the guy in the room".
10. Critique code instead of people – be kind to the coder, not to the code.

OpenTelemetry 101: The basics OpenTelemetry is an open source observability framework created by the merger of OpenTracing and OpenCensus. Aiming to be robust, portable, and easy to instrument across many languages, OpenTelemetry provides a single set of APIs, libraries, agents, and collector services to capture distributed traces and metrics from your application. 2020

kraken
Kraken is a P2P-powered Docker registry that focuses on scalability and availability. It is designed for Docker image management, replication, and distribution in a hybrid cloud environment. With pluggable backend support, Kraken can easily integrate into existing Docker registry setups as the distribution layer.

Kraken has been in production at Uber since early 2018. In our busiest cluster, Kraken distributes more than 1 million blobs per day, including 100k 1G+ blobs. At its peak production load, Kraken distributes 20K 100MB-1G blobs in under 30 sec.

11 facts about real-world container use
Containers enable organizations to accelerate delivery cycles and rapidly scale their operations to meet the demands of today's fast-paced market. As more organizations migrate their workloads to containers, the container ecosystem is expanding and evolving to accommodate these increasingly dynamic environments. In this report, we examined more than 1.5 billion containers run by tens of thousands of Datadog customers to understand how image registries, service meshes, networking, and other technologies are being used in real-world container environments.
